MySQL 9.0 發行說明
USER_PRIVILEGES
表格提供有關全域權限的資訊。它從 mysql.user
系統表格取得其值。
USER_PRIVILEGES
表格具有以下欄位
GRANTEE
授予權限的帳戶名稱,格式為
'
。user_name
'@'host_name
'TABLE_CATALOG
目錄的名稱。此值始終為
def
。PRIVILEGE_TYPE
授予的權限。該值可以是可在全域層級授予的任何權限;請參閱 第 15.7.1.6 節「GRANT 陳述式」。每個資料列列出單一權限,因此每個被授予者持有的全域權限都有一個資料列。
IS_GRANTABLE
如果使用者擁有
GRANT OPTION
權限,則為YES
,否則為NO
。輸出不會將GRANT OPTION
列為具有PRIVILEGE_TYPE='GRANT OPTION'
的單獨資料列。
注意事項
USER_PRIVILEGES
是非標準的INFORMATION_SCHEMA
表格。
以下陳述式不等效
SELECT ... FROM INFORMATION_SCHEMA.USER_PRIVILEGES
SHOW GRANTS ...